Daniel Bouyer is a scholar working on Plant Science, Molecular Biology and Cell Biology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Daniel Bouyer has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 1.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Plant Science, 17 papers in Molecular Biology and 2 papers in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Daniel Bouyer’s work include Plant Molecular Biology Research (19 papers), Plant Reproductive Biology (9 papers) and Plant nutrient uptake and metabolism (5 papers). Daniel Bouyer is often cited by papers focused on Plant Molecular Biology Research (19 papers), Plant Reproductive Biology (9 papers) and Plant nutrient uptake and metabolism (5 papers). Daniel Bouyer collaborates with scholars based in France, Germany and Belgium. Daniel Bouyer's co-authors include Arp Schnittger, Martin Hülskamp, Hirofumi Harashima, Maren Heese and Moritz K. Nowack and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nature Communications and The EMBO Journal.
